Silver-gray foliage that adds texture in the garden. Strong aromatic leaves when crushed. Provides excellent contrast to flowering plants and green foliage. Great selection for beds, borders and rock gardens.

Homeowner Growing and Maintenance Tips:
Prefers well drained soil and full sun Drought tolerant Thrives in hot sunny location
Height: 8-10 in
Spread: 12-24 in
Spacing: 12-15 in
